complete verse (Job 36:18)

Following are a number of back-translations as well as a sample translation for translators of Job 36:18:

  • Kupsabiny: “Do not let anger lead you to disobey/disrespect God.
    Bring yourself down and repent even though it may be hard.” (Source: Kupsabiny Back Translation)
  • Newari: “Be careful! Do not let anyone lure you with wealth and property,
    Do not let [anyone] take you down the wrong path with bribes!” (Source: Newari Back Translation)
  • Hiligaynon: “[You (sing.)] be-careful that you (sing.) will- not -be-enticed with wealth and be-carried-away with lots/[lit. many] of money as bribes.” (Source: Hiligaynon Back Translation)
  • English: “So be careful that you are not deceived by desiring to acquire money
    or that you are not ruined by accepting large bribes.” (Source: Translation for Translators)
